[Bug 1162263] Re: Plymouth shows text only when switching to NVIDIA proprietary drivers in Xubuntu 13.04

This is not a bug in Plymouth. The nvidia binary drivers have
blacklisted the loading of all framebuffer drivers in the kernel,
leaving Plymouth with no way to render a graphical splash.

As stated in the title, switching to NVIDIA proprietary drivers in
Xubuntu 13.04 will render Plymouth in text mode only. I have
experienced this problem since 12.10 and as reported by other users in
several forums this affects AMD drivers as well. Using the default
Nouveau Drivers produces no problems, Plymouth graphical splash
displays correctly.
